Output 899ab5c861726c6d481e17cb2651374b51bfa4d56332919ccdc7c8f1f37d7021:0

value
665803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ab781e62cb345bc2c67da478c936425b12f8e6c OP_EQUAL
address
3HFgdUSQY6wJjefg45qCmDVf1HfDZydDkh
transaction
899ab5c861726c6d481e17cb2651374b51bfa4d56332919ccdc7c8f1f37d7021
spent
true